Step 1

Bake seasoned potatoes 15 minutes at 200°C/400°F (180°C fan). Toss capsicum and onion with oil, salt & pepper, add to tray, toss. Dot with sausage meat (squeeze out), sprinkle with bacon, bake 35 minutes, tossing at the 20 minute mark. Reduce oven to 180°C/350°F (160°C fan). Make wells, crack in eggs, bake 7 minutes or until set to your taste.

Step 2

Preheat the oven to 200°C / 400°F (180°C fan-forced).

Step 3

Toss the potatoes with the oil and seasoning in a bowl. Spread on a lined tray, just big enough to hold everything in snugly rather than spread in a single layer (Note 3). Bake for 15 minutes.

Step 4

Capsicum and onion - Meanwhile, in the still-dirty potato bowl, toss the capsicum and onion with the oil, salt and pepper. Add to tray, then toss with the potatoes.

Step 5

Sausage & bacon - Squeeze dollops of the sausage meat out of the casings and dot them randomly on top (you could cut the sausages using a knife, but that just isn't as fun). Scatter with bacon.

Step 6

Bake 35 minutes - Bake 20 minutes. Toss, then bake for a further 15 minutes, or until potatoes are soft.

Step 7

Lower oven to 180°C/350°F (160°C fan).

Step 8

Eggs - Push the potato aside to make holes for the eggs. Crack eggs in. Return to oven for 7 minutes or until eggs are done to your liking (I like runny yolks which means just-set whites!).

Step 9

Serve - Scatter with parsley, then serve!
